Weaving

Weaving is the process of interlacing strands of material, typically yarn or thread, to create fabric. This is done on a loom, where two sets of threads are used: the warp (vertical threads) and the weft (horizontal threads). By crossing these threads over and under each other, different patterns and textures can be created. Weaving has been a fundamental technique in textile production for thousands of years, allowing for the creation of clothing, household items, and art. Its variations and techniques contribute to the diversity of fabrics seen around the world today.
